    LEAF COLLECTION BEGINS MONDAY, NOVEMBER 1ST (NO SET END DATE)

    The City of Peru provides leaf vacuum collection for residents during the fall. Collection schedules and routes may be found here, on the city website and city calendar.

    Residents are asked to please observe the following guidelines:

    • Leaves must be raked to the curb, but not in the street. Leaves in the street restrict water flow to sewers and cause flooding.
    • Leaves must be curbside no later than 7:00 a.m. on your scheduled pick-up day.
    • Only leaves will be collected. Leaf piles with twigs, brush, branches, rocks, grass clippings or other materials mixed in will not be collected to avoid damage to vacuum equipment.
    • Provide clear access to leaf piles. Do not park vehicles in front of leaves. Please keep leaves 4-5 feet away from mailboxes, poles, fire hydrants, guy wires or other potential obstructions.
    • Do not bag leaves or put in cans.
    • Once a street, neighborhood or route is completed, the truck is unable to return to that location until the next scheduled collection date.
    • Leaf collection can be affected by both weather and volume of leaves. Every effort will be made to collect leaves from your street on the scheduled date.

    LEAF COLLECTION ROUTES
    Monday: 4th Street north from the west side of Calhoun Street to west end city limits.

    Tuesday: 4th Street north from east side of Peoria Street to Route 251.

    Wednesday: East side of Calhoun Street to west side of Peoria Street.

    Thursday: West side of Pulaski Street to Route 251 and 4th Street south from the east side of Peoria Street to Route 251

    Friday: East side of Pulaski Street to east end city limits and 4th Street south from west side of Calhoun Street to the west end city limits.

    YARD WASTE PICKUP OPTION

    As an alternative to leaf vacuum collection, residents may also put leaves in 30-gallon biodegradable yard waste bags. No stickers needed - the city has waived the requirement for 2021.  Republic Services will pick up yard waste on November 5th, 12th, 19th and 27th.  Bags should be placed at the curb prior to 6:00 a.m.
